Apologies for nit-picking, but St. Andrew's day has been a 'semi-public holiday' since 2007. Employers can choose whether to:
  1. Allow their staff to have the day off,
  2. Allow them the day off but remove a day from their total number of days off per year, or
  3. Not have the day off at all.

St. Patrick's day is a public holiday in Northern Ireland.
